Output 193f4090366bf4700a754e6e9b12192de8c88389c35eb6f0003d6d43b21764d5:6

value
438586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f3185b9d5d8b68395bf317468966e6e396c07a5 OP_EQUAL
address
335MPJ6bSYYZYoiFfbLcNWJdkk8evGmEPv
transaction
193f4090366bf4700a754e6e9b12192de8c88389c35eb6f0003d6d43b21764d5
confirmations
266704
spent
true